Agency Type: Non-Profit No registration fee – the MS Society's main purpose is to inform MS clients and their families about multiple sclerosis, services and programs offered through the Keystone Branch. Information and referral services are available. PROGRAMS: AQUATICS PROGRAMS Program designed specifically for the MS client and offers therapeutic water movement to help sustain and improve muscular and joint mobility. Held Tuesdays and Thursdays at the Hollidaysburg YMCA from 1:00 – 2:00 PM. Lifts are available for those who need assistance getting in and out of the water. Ability to swim is not necessary. Eligibility: MS Registration LENDING LIBRARY Various VCR videos and books are available to groups and individuals which outline multiple sclerosis and current research as well as services provided by the Society. To promote a better understanding of MS and its effects upon the entire family. Eligibility: MS Registration. SUPPORT GROUP Held once a month, MS clients and their spouses are encouraged to attend. Guest speakers, films and rap sessions are offered. To promote sociability among clients and give spouses an opportunity to understand ways in which other spouses are coping with their loved ones’ chronic illness. Eligibility: MS registration (client only). PEER COUNSELING Peer counseling involves clients with MS talking to other clients with MS to help them with problems they may be having that only others with MS would understand.
